David S. Goldberg, Esq., has practiced
law in Maryland since 1967, with a heavy concentration in family
and divorce law. He is a 1963 graduate of the University of
Maryland and received his law degree in 1966 from Georgetown
University Law Center. He is a member of the Maryland State,
Montgomery County, and Queen Anne's County Bar Associations, and
is licensed to practice law in all state and Federal courts in
Maryland and D.C. including the United States Tax Court and the
Supreme Court of the United States.
Mr. Goldberg is a Practitioner Member of
the Academy of Family Mediators, and a member of the
Association for Conflict Resolution. He is a founding member
and currently serves as President of the
Maryland
Society of Professional Family Mediators, and is a
member of the Regional Advisory Board for the
Maryland Alternative
Dispute Resolution Commission.
Mr.
Goldberg has the highest Martindale-Hubbell rating, AV -
Preeminent, for ethical standards and for professional ability
(legal knowledge, analytical capabilities, judgment,
communication ability, and legal experience) based upon
evaluations submitted by his fellow lawyers and by members of
the judiciary.
